Man attacked pensioner in 'sustained assault'

Man who attacked pensioner in sustained assault carried knife and pistol A MAN who attacked a pensioner in his own home also carried a pistol and a large knife.  Matthew Smith, 23, of Milton Road, Waterlooville, was sentenced to eight years in prison yesterday (Thursday 28 January) at Portsmouth Crown Court for firearms and knife offences and an attempted robbery. He was sentenced for possession of a firearm without a certificate and possession of a knife in a public place in relation to an incident that took place in September 2019. On September 16, 2019, after a report from a member of the public, Smith was arrested by officers leaving Fratton train station after being found in possession of a pistol and a large knife. No-one was injured.

Prolific burglar jailed following crime spree across Hampshire

A MAN who went on a four-and-a-half-month burgling spree across Hampshire has been jailed for three years. Sonnie Marsh, 23, pleaded guilty to seven counts of burglary, seven counts of fraud by false representation and one count of handling stolen goods following incidents at various locations in Winchester, Liphook, Portsmouth, Southsea. These incidents occurred between August 19 last year and January 5. Portsmouth Crown Court heard on the 15 January how Marsh, of Victoria Road North, Southsea, had begun his spree of offending at a pub in Winchester when he stole a charity pot containing £250. He was found later that day attempting to gain entry into a school in Winchester with a view to stealing property.
